THE BATTLE BELONGS TO THE LORD
It does not matter where you are in your life; it only matters where God is going to take you. His light is our solace in a lost and perishing world. The word of God promises us that we will have peace despite our situation and that he has a plan to give us a future with hope. Jesus has paid the price for our victory in every circumstance. There is never a battle that can defeat you. It is only when you understand that you are more than a conqueror through Jesus Christ that you can believe that God’s strength and his perfect plan for you life are all that you need.
Too often the storms of life can leave you weary making it a struggle to stand in faith. The enemy who roams this earth seeking to kill, steal and destroy will use every effort to make you doubt that God cares about your difficult situation. Satan is the father of lies and he will try to use your heartache and pain to rob you of your joy. The truth is that he cannot steal the purpose and plan for which God sent his only Son to redeem for us.
We read in 1 Peter 5:10 that, “The God of all grace who called you to his eternal glory in Christ, after you have suffered a little while, will himself restore you and make you strong, firm and steadfast.” The storms that this life brings will be turned around for your good and will bring you to the knowledge of how wide and long and high and deep is the love of Christ.(Ephesians 3:18} It is only after you have been in a painful battle and watched as your God defeated all of your problems that you can grow in unwavering trust.
Nothing can overcome you when your life is in Christ. He is your power and the force to go on even despite the pain you may be experiencing. God is never limited by the impossibility of your situation. He who spoke the world into existence has a way out of every trial you endure. In Scripture we read that it was God who shut the mouth of the lions and saved Daniel when he was thrown into their den for not bowing down to the king. It was God who went with young David to defeat the giant. It is always the strength of God who meets us at the battle and takes down our enemies. We have nothing to fear because the word of God promises us that we cannot be destroyed.
You may be facing a serious illness, an addiction, a broken marriage, or financial problems but you need to know that God is willing and able to take you through your struggle that you may be anxious for nothing. We are told in Isaiah 26 that God will keep in perfect peace him whose mind is steadfast because he trusts in the one who can do all things.
You can be hard-pressed but never crushed by your problems. God knows your name and saw all of your days before one of them came to be. Jesus will guide your steps and be the light when the darkness of your situation is overwhelming. And he will never leave your side.
There will always be battles that come against you in your life, but Jesus tells us to take joy for he has overcome them all!
